When considering central air conditioning installations, the pros look at factors like existing ductwork, insulation R-values, and solar heat gain specific to the Indiana climate to recommend appropriate tonnage and SEER ratings. For those exploring ductless mini-split systems, particularly in properties where running new ductwork is impractical or cost-prohibitive, the specialists assess wall structure for refrigerant line and electrical conduit routing. These installations demand precise refrigerant line brazing and evacuation procedures to ensure long-term system reliability. The crew that comes out will also verify proper condensate drain line installation to prevent water damage. When you are looking at the price of a new HVAC system, several variables come into play. The total depends heavily on the square footage of your home, the existing ductwork condition, and the efficiency rating of the unit you choose. Opting for advanced features like smart thermostats or high-performance air filtration will also shift the final number. If we need to modify your home’s electrical setup or gas lines to accommodate the new equipment, that adds to the labor requirements.
Ductless mini-splits are priced based on the number of indoor heads required and the distance from the outdoor compressor. Installation involves mounting units on interior walls and running small refrigerant lines through your walls, which is less invasive than traditional ductwork.
